摘要
在 Na2 HPO4介质中 ,研究了 Fe( )催化 H2 O2 氧化甲基百里酚蓝褪色指示反应及其动力学条件 ,建立了测定痕量铁的新方法。方法的线性范围为 0 .0 2~ 0 .2 5μg/2 5m L,检出限为 0 .0 1 2 μg/2 5m L。用以测定过氧化碳酸钠 ( 2 Na2 CO3· 3H2 O2 )中的铁 ,结果令人满意。
A kinetic sepectrophotometry for the determination of trace iron has been developed. It is based on the reaction of methylthymol blue complexone with H 2O 2 in Na 2HPO 4 mediam by the catalysis of Fe 3+ . The linear range of the method is 0.02~0.25 μg/25 mL, and the detection limit is 0.012 μg/25 mL. The method has been used to determine trace Fe 3+ in 2Na 2CO 3·3H 2O 2 with satisfactory results.
